HOT NEWS! Korean Noir ‘Night In Paradise’ Gets A Release Date On Netflix

Netflix has announced the release date and the first look of the much anticipated Korean noir film ‘Night In Paradise’. Written and directed by Park Hoon-jung, known for his noir genre films including intense storytelling and action scenes, ‘Night In Paradise’ will premiere globally on Netflix on 9th April, 2021.

As per the official synopsis, ‘Night In Paradise’ on Netflix “tells a story of a man targeted by a criminal organization and a woman on the verge of life and death”. It is the only Korean film to have received an out of competition selection for the 77th Venice International Film Festival.

Having received worldwide acclaim, many have marked ‘Night In Paradise’ as a must watch Korean film. The movie stars Um Tae-goo (‘The Age of Shadows’, ‘The Great Battle’), Jeon Yeo-been (‘After My Death’) , Cha Seoung-won (‘Believer’) among others.

Previous credits of director Park Hoon-jung include ‘The Unjust’, ‘I Saw the Devil’, ‘New World’, ‘V.I.P.’, ‘The Witch: Part 1’ and ‘The Subversion’. These various hits have established him as a great filmmaker in the Korean film industry. He skilfully weaves stylistic elements into action-driven plots.

‘Night In Paradise’ has been produced by Goldmoon and co-produced by Peppermint & company, Inc. It will launch in over 190 countries only on Netflix on 9th April, 2021.
